Understanding Swift’s Experiment

What is Swift?

Swift, short for the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ication, is a cooperative organization that provides a secure and standardized messaging network for financial institutions worldwide. It is pivotal in facilitating global financial transactions and communications among banks and other financial entities.

Chainlink’s CCIP

Chainlink’s CCIP, or Cross-Chain Integration Protocol, is a cutting-edge technology that connects different blockchain networks and enables seamless communication and data sharing across these platforms. It acts as a bridge between various blockchains, ensuring interoperability and enhanced functionality.

Understanding Tokenization

What is Tokenization?

Before we dive into Swift’s experiment, it’s crucial to grasp the concept of tokenization. Tokenization converts real-world assets, such as stocks, real estate, or commodities, into digital tokens on a blockchain. These tokens represent ownership or rights to the underlying assets, making them more accessible and tradable on blockchain platforms.

The Significance of Tokenization

Tokenization holds immense potential in the financial world. It promises increased liquidity, reduced transaction costs, and improved accessibility to a wide range of assets. Furthermore, it enhances security and transparency, as blockchain technology ensures the immutability of transaction records.
